Flexible tubular heaters

Tubular heating elements are extremely durable, resistant to contamination, and quite economical. They can be used on dies, radiant, thermoforming, and hot runner manifold applications. Tubular heaters provide temperatures up to 649°C and offer tremendous design flexibility. [Pg.254]

Heating equipment. Flexible Nichrome heater wire consisting of a Nichrome inner wire, asbestos and glass insulation, and a flexible stainless steel protective braid, is extremely useful for maintaining systems at temperatures up to 1100°F for periods of time in excess of 10,000 hr [22]. Figure 23-6 shows the application of this type of heater in loop work. Strip and tubular heaters have been in in-pile service for over 8000 hr [34]. A resistance heater has also been used as an internal heater submerged in a lead-bismuth eutectic system [29]. [Pg.852]
